Install even more stuff
authorMichael Spang <mspang@csclub.uwaterloo.ca>
Mon, 14 Dec 2009 23:16:30 +0000 (18:16 -0500)
committerMichael Spang <mspang@csclub.uwaterloo.ca>
Sun, 11 Jul 2010 21:41:41 +0000 (17:41 -0400)
nodes.ia
packages.ia

index 06676f6..842df17 100644 (file)
--- a/nodes.ia
+++ b/nodes.ia
@@ -19,7 +19,7 @@ profiles server amd64;
 profiles server i386;
 
 @taurine
-profiles server amd64 X general-use;
+profiles server amd64 X general-use csclub;
 
 @corn-syrup
 profiles server amd64;
index 0f111df..9a367b3 100644 (file)
@@ -47,7 +47,7 @@ if machine-core {
 };
 
 if auth-core {
-    install nscd libnss-ldapd ldap-utils libpam-krb5 ldapvi;
+    install nscd libnss-ldapd ldap-utils libpam-krb5 krb5-user ldapvi;
 
     @csclub
     install libpam-csc;
@@ -82,7 +82,7 @@ if devel-full {
 
     # essentials
     install gcc-doc cpp-doc glibc-doc glibc-doc-reference
-            binutils-doc
+            binutils-doc binutils-multiarch
             manpages-posix-dev
             @x86 gcc-multilib;
 
@@ -104,13 +104,13 @@ if devel-full {
     # build systems
     install make-doc ccache distcc ant ant-optional bake scons qt4-qmake
             cmake autogen autoconf-doc autoconf2.13 automake1.9
-            automake1.9-doc autotools-dev autoproject;
+            automake1.9-doc autotools-dev autoproject kbuild;
 
     # version control
     install git-core git-email git-cvs git-svn git-arch git-doc
             git-buildpackage guilt stgit mercurial subversion subversion-tools
             svk darcs bzr rcs cvs cvsps cssc tla tla-doc diff wdiff
-            colordiff xxdiff tkdiff patch patchutils quilt
+            colordiff xxdiff tkdiff patch patchutils quilt tig diffstat
             @x86 monotone
             @X gitk
             @X git-gui;
@@ -151,10 +151,14 @@ if devel-full {
             python-openssl python-pexpect python-pgsql python-pyasn1
             python-pysnmp4 python-sqlobject python-subversion python-tk
             python-urwid python-xmpp drpython ipython pylint pychecker
-            pyflakes jython;
+            pyflakes jython jython-doc
+            python-beautifulsoup python-chardet python-clientform python-cups
+            python-cupsutils python-kerberos python-mako python-notify python-pyme
+            python-rpm python-selinux python-setuptools python-simplejson
+            python-sqlite python-sqlitecachec python-urlgrabber;
 
     # ruby
-    install ruby ruby-dev rubygems irb rake;
+    install ruby ruby-dev rubygems irb rake ruby1.9 ruby1.9-dev;
 
     # llvm
     install llvm llvm-dev
@@ -197,17 +201,24 @@ if devel-full {
     # gui tools
     install @X glade xutils-dev;
 
+    # integrated development environments
+    @X install eclipse;
+
+    # manuals
+    install stl-manual;
+
     # miscellaneous
-    install bcc chrpath openmpi-bin openmpi-doc;
+    install bcc chrpath openmpi-bin openmpi-doc protobuf-compiler
+            protobuf-c-compiler;
 };
 
 if general-use {
 
     # shells
-    install zsh-beta bash-completion zsh-doc zsh-beta-doc bashdb;
+    install bash-doc zsh-beta bash-completion zsh-doc zsh-beta-doc bashdb;
 
     # editors
-    install nvi
+    install nvi joe
             @X vim-gnome;
 
     # crypto
@@ -215,7 +226,8 @@ if general-use {
 
     # network
     install ipset ipcalc iftop nmap openipmi ipmitool cdpr lksctp-tools
-            lftp
+            iptables ebtables
+            lftp ncftp
             @x86 syslinux
             @X wireshark;
 
@@ -223,7 +235,7 @@ if general-use {
     install w3m links elinks lynx axel curl;
 
     # typesetting
-    install groff texlive-full dvi2ps dvipng dvidvi
+    install groff texlive-full dvi2ps dvipng dvidvi djvulibre-bin
             @X texmacs
             @X lyx;
 
@@ -246,13 +258,13 @@ if general-use {
 
     # documentation
     install texinfo texi2html asciidoc jade jadetex openjade wv iso-codes
-            man2html;
+            man2html help2man info2man docbook2x txt2man;
 
     # spelling
     install aspell-en ispell myspell-en-us iamerican wamerican;
 
     # emacs
-    install emacs-jabber gnus ede
+    install emacs-jabber gnus ede ocaml-mode tuareg-mode
             @X xemacs21
             @X emacs22-gtk @!X emacs22-nox;
 
@@ -278,17 +290,24 @@ if general-use {
 
     # communication
     install mutt alpine tin irssi efax mailx procmail centerim finch fetchmail
-            nn slrn spamassassin pine;
+            nn slrn spamassassin pine trn4;
 
     # utilities
     install rdiff dosfstools tofrodos mc wodim socat snmp busybox
             bonnie++ latencytop time bsdmainutils dctrl-tools ddrescue gddrescue
             file parchive par2 realpath reportbug rpm shtool smbclient stow xstow
-            sysstat unison john iotop sg3-utils
+            sysstat unison john iotop sg3-utils attr dstat i2c-tools
+            rstat-client dnstracer parted tree
             @x86 syslinux;
 
     # serial
     install conserver-client minicom cu;
+
+    # virtualization
+    install qemu;
+
+    @csclub
+    install ceo-python;
 };
 
 if X {
@@ -296,7 +315,7 @@ if X {
     install xserver-xorg xfonts-base;
 
     # utils
-    install xauth xsel gksu;
+    install xauth xsel gksu sux;
 
     # terminal emulators
     install xterm gnome-terminal rxvt rxvt-unicode yakuake;
@@ -311,7 +330,7 @@ if X {
     # office
     install openoffice.org gnome-office scribus
             gimp xfig dia inkscape imagemagick blender fontforge
-            xpdf evince gthumb eog;
+            xpdf evince gthumb eog djview4;
 
     # communications
     install firefox/iceweasel thunderbird/icedove epiphany-browser
@@ -323,7 +342,9 @@ if X {
             @karmic ardour;
 
     # gnome
-    install gdm gdm-themes gnome-core gnome-office gnome-themes;
+    install gdm gdm-themes gnome-core gnome-office gnome-themes
+            gnome-themes-extras gnome-desktop-environment
+            rhythmbox;
 
     # kde
     install kdebase kdebase-runtime kdeutils
@@ -335,9 +356,6 @@ if X {
 
     # miscellaneous
     install gucharmap gmrun dzen2 xserver-xephyr wine;
-
-    # tweaks
-    @lenny install gnome-desktop-environment;
 };
 
 @csclub remove gnome-games nethack-common;